Responsibilities
- Assess, treat, and manage sports-related injuries.
- Develop and monitor rehabilitation programmes for injured athletes.
- Provide sports massage and taping services.
- Assess athletes' fitness and readiness for training and competitions.
- Refer athletes to appropriate healthcare professionals when necessary.
- Supervise and guide Assistant Physiotherapists.
- Ensure appropriate use of physiotherapy equipment during treatment.
Requirements
- Degree in Physiotherapy or equivalent.
- Registered with the Allied Health Professions Council (AHPC), Singapore.
- Valid Standard First Aid (SFA) and AED certification.
- Minimum 2 years of physiotherapy experience.
- Experience in sports physiotherapy is an advantage.
